Hello Group - ADR (MOMO) Covered Calls
Hello Group Inc. operates as a mobile-first social networking and live-streaming entertainment platform in Asia. The enterprise develops communication applications, interactive video matching systems, digital dating connection engines, and virtual gift transactions. By deploying scaled algorithmic community hubs across its core Momo and Tantan ecosystems, the organization coordinates premium digital relationship loops.

Hello Group Inc. operates a scaled mobile social networking engine, live-video entertainment broadcasting infrastructure, and automated gamified matching framework within the technology and interactive media sectors, specialized in mobile connection loops. The corporation directs multi-platform mobile application instances, localized real-time video rendering pipelines, secure digital wallet token engines, and complex user recommendation algorithmic systems. By embedding micro-transaction frameworks directly into live peer-to-peer feeds, the company operates as a primary digital monetization utility.
The enterprise yields its primary revenue configurations through value-added services and live-video interactions, powered by high-volume user purchases of virtual gifts, premium membership tiers, and localized subscription packages across its primary Momo and Tantan app portals.
Competitive Landscape
The international interactive entertainment marketplace, digital matchmaking grid, and mobile social network arena are intensely competitive, sensitive to user acquisition costs, and highly responsive to shifting youth lifestyle cultures, consumer discretionary spending levels, and regional regulatory compliance layers. Hello Group competes based on its structural user base density, algorithmic pairing accuracy scores, live-talent agency network integrations, and multi-app portfolio segmentation. Key industry peers with highly optionable equities trading on major exchanges include:
- Match Group, Inc.: Coordinates a massive global portfolio of premium digital dating applications and relationship platforms with immense public option chain liquidity.
- Bumble Inc.: Operates an absolute international leader in user-driven social connection networks and mobile dating technologies backed by an exceptionally active options framework.
- HUYA Inc.: Directs a substantial live-streaming game and interactive entertainment broadcasting network in Asia across major liquid public options trading grids.
- Baidu, Inc.: Directs substantial internet search, localized social discovery frameworks, and automated digital media distribution portals, serving as an elite option tracking benchmark.
Strategic Outlook and Innovation
Hello Group Inc. is focused on aggressively scaling its higher-margin overseas social and companion applications, actively building out regional distribution networks across the Middle East and Southeast Asia to diversify core corporate revenue streams outside of its domestic operational baselines. The enterprise's long-term business layout prioritizes sustaining strong operating cash conversions, utilizing strict talent-agency revenue share boundaries to optimize monetization pools while executing massive capital return programs through consistent special dividend payouts and share buybacks. This capital return structure stabilizes baseline equity valuations.
Future engineering priorities center on deploying advanced artificial intelligence-driven user matching algorithms and automated content recommendations directly across its audio-chat rooms, allowing digital systems to optimize localized interactions and reduce chat friction in real time. The company continues to implement cloud-native spatial computing social applications, including native platforms built for augmented reality headsets, to pioneer immersive virtual room interactions. These platform transformations are engineered to safeguard gross margins and fortify operational cash flow runways.

Covered Call Strategy Risks: While covered call writing is often considered a conservative options strategy, it is not without risk. By selling a covered call, you are limiting your potential upside profit from the underlying stock. You remain exposed to the full downside risk of owning the underlying stock. In the event of a significant decline in the stock price, the premium received may not be sufficient to offset your losses.
